The Security Challenges Faced by the Site
The e-commerce site, like many large online businesses, faced several serious security challenges. These included a high volume of traffic, sensitive customer data, and an ever-evolving threat landscape. The site was also a prime target for cybercriminals due to its prominent position in the e-commerce industry.
One of the main challenges was the constant influx of new threats and vulnerabilities. Every update to the site’s software, every new feature added, and every third-party integration could potentially introduce new vulnerabilities. This made it difficult for the site’s security team to keep up with potential threats.
Another challenge was the site’s complex infrastructure. The site relied on a range of technologies, from web servers and databases to payment gateways and content delivery networks. Each component required its own security measures, making the task of securing the entire site a complex and time-consuming endeavor.
Finally, the site had to contend with regulatory compliance issues. As an e-commerce business, it was subject to regulations such as the GDPR, which require rigorous data protection measures. Failing to comply with these regulations could result in hefty fines and damage to the site’s reputation.

Process & Approach
In this case study on how a major e-commerce site improved security with web vulnerability scanning, the process followed a three-step approach. This encompassed understanding the initial security framework, identifying key vulnerabilities, and implementing security measures.
Understanding the Initial Security Framework
The first step involved gaining a comprehensive understanding of the e-commerce site’s initial security framework. This required a thorough review of the existing security policies, procedures, and technologies in place. The review took into consideration various factors such as encryption practices, firewalls, intrusion detection systems, and application-level security mechanisms.
To gain additional insights, the team also conducted a series of interviews with key personnel who were involved in managing and maintaining the site’s security infrastructure. This helped in gathering information about potential gaps in the security framework, and areas that required improvement.
Identifying Key Vulnerabilities
The second step involved conducting a rigorous web vulnerability scanning process to identify key vulnerabilities in the site’s security framework. This encompassed scanning the site’s entire network infrastructure, including servers, databases, and applications.
The scanning process highlighted several critical vulnerabilities that were potentially exploitable by malicious actors. These vulnerabilities were categorized based on their severity levels, as shown in the table below:
Severity Level | Number of Vulnerabilities |
---|---|
High | 25 |
Medium | 45 |
Low | 70 |

Implementing Security Measures
The final step involved implementing robust security measures to address the identified vulnerabilities. This involved patching software vulnerabilities, strengthening encryption practices, enhancing firewall configurations, and improving intrusion detection capabilities.
Moreover, the site also implemented regular web vulnerability scanning as part of its ongoing security practices to ensure timely identification and remediation of any new vulnerabilities.
